AMJ expands disputes team

Al Busaidy, Mansoor Jamal and Co (AMJ) has announced the appointment of Erik Penz as special counsel in its litigation and arbitration department.  His hire boosts the Muscat-based Litigation team to two senior partners, three special counsel, ten associates and four trainees, the largest in the country.

Penz joins from Norton Rose in Toronto, Canada where he was a partner. He has extensive experience of handling complex, multi-jurisdictional disputes across a wide range of sectors, including energy, construction, transport and mining. These cases include multijurisdictional and multi-party proceedings, high-value commercial disputes, insolvency proceedings, fraud and asset-tracing, company/joint-venture/partnership disputes, employment litigation and administrative law matters. He advises clients including multinational corporations, foreign governments/state-owned enterprises, and listed companies, including in the natural-resource and transport sectors.

He is an experienced advocate appearing before the Court of Appeal for Ontario, the Divisional Court, the Superior Court of Justice, arbitration panels and administrative tribunals.  In addition to his advocacy on behalf of clients, Erik has extensive experience advising on claims, liabilities, risk mitigation, and dispute-resolution strategy.
